③ Core Message on Goal Setting

  • “If your goal doesn’t excite you, it’s not your fault — it’s a goal-setting mistake.”
     → If your goal feels hard or painful, it likely means the goal itself is wrong.

     → Rebuild it around what truly excites you.

  • Set your goals in World 2 (beyond your current reality) rather than World 1 (within your current limits).
     → Goals in World 1 tend to stay within what seems possible through effort or talent → no real change.

     →World 2 goals lie beyond your capacity — and that’s where new ideas, chances, and people begin to appear.

  • When you’re close to achieving it, move the goal outward again — to World 3.
     → A goal that feels “almost within reach” has likely slipped back into World 1.

     → Keep setting goals in the unknown zone (“obogena” world) to keep your life evolving.

🧠 Summary: “Living Brain Cells Power New Bio-Computers”

Main point:
We’re not heading toward a Matrix-style world where humans are used as batteries — that’s scientifically inefficient and unrealistic.
But we are entering an era where living human brain cells are being used as computing components.


What’s Really Happening

  • Brain-cell chips (Organoid Intelligence): Researchers grow human neurons on electrode arrays to process data.

  • DishBrain experiment: Cultured neurons learned to play the game Pong on their own.

  • Commercial step: Australia’s Cortical Labs “CL1” already sells a bio-computer powered by living neurons.

  • Why it matters: The human brain performs massive computation using only ~20 watts — scientists want to copy that energy efficiency.


Ethical Concerns

  • Could these cell clusters ever become conscious?

  • Who owns or gives consent for the cells used?

  • How far should commercialization go?


⚡ In Short

Using humans as energy sources = science fiction.
Using human brain cells as processors = already science fact — though small-scale and ethically complex.


These technologies may feel like something out of science fiction, but much of the fundamental research is already underway — and as their feasibility increases, the height of the ethical “wall” is becoming the real challenge.
